I have been really enjoying my makeup collection lately - revelling in some new treats, using old favourites and just generally digging my whole stash. A late start at work resulted in me playing around with these beauties, and I was chuffed with the natural look I created.
Too Faced Ringleader is a certified kick-ass shade (bottom left shade in the Pretty Rebel palette!) It is glowy but natural on the lid and much less peachy than I had first thought. Paired with my new shadow obsessed MAC Club (housed in the gorgeous Royal Assets palette) it created a look I loved - so much so that I've been recreating the look by pairing Club with other shades all week.
I probably should have called this look the staples look, as I've been rocking this blush and lip duo quite frequently as well now that I think about it! I think I spent a total of 45mins contemplating my Hourglass Ambient Lighting Blush in Radiant Magenta before snatching it up - I hadn't really given them much thought before, so my knee-jerk purchase was a nice surprise on the day. The colour in the pan isn't really translated onto the cheek in my opinion, but the airbrush-esque finish is covetable and I'm one happy chappy.
El cheapo lipstick (Kmart Moisturising lipstick in Naked) + Luxe and pricy gloss (Dior Addict Gloss 363 Dormeuse) = my favourite lip look of late.
Add in some other current staples like Revlon Lash Potion and Too Faced Shadow Insurance and I'm good to go!
